Like their government-insured competitors, standard mortgage loans need financial insurance coverage as soon as the loan-to-value are more than 80%. Old-fashioned loans make use of personal home loan insurance rates (PMI).

PMI goes away completely alone, eventually, due to the fact LTV gets to 80% or lower. That’s a stark distinction to FHA financial loans which carry home loan insurance rates the life of the loan (debtor must refinance to get out of MI).

Federal national mortgage association HomeReady

Federal national mortgage association HomeReady try a reduced downpayment mortgage for creditworthy, low to moderate-income borrowers. Down payments is as low as 3per cent. Both first-time or repeat home buyers meet the requirements. In late 2015, this product changed Fannie Mae’s MyCommunityMortgage program.

HomeReady acknowledges that there may be wider family participation home based possession. There is a large number of homes in the us incorporate expanded and multi-generational family. This means there are many more prospective contributors to a household’s loan-qualifying income. HomeReady’s underwriting rules enable consideration of non-borrower family money (definition, money from men and women not legally on the mortgage mention) as a compensating factor.

Non-Conforming Financing in Ca (Jumbo)

Home prices in California tend to be large compared to a lot of says in america. Consumers right here often require more substantial mortgage, one which goes beyond conforming mortgage limitations. That’s when jumbo mortgages be useful. Jumbo debts can be found in amounts to $3 million.

How do you know if you will want a jumbo mortgage?

As in the above list, $417,000 could be the mortgage restriction in many Ca counties. Financing limits in “high price” markets in Ca can move up to $625,000. High price areas put Los Angeles, Alameda, Contra Costa, Marin, Napa, Orange, San Benito, San Francisco, San Mateo, Santa Barbara, Santa Clara and Santa Cruz areas.

Reverse Mortgages

Homeowners in Ca who’re 62-years older or old can use a reverse home loan to make use of the equity of these home while continuing to be with it. Borrowers can’t be evicted using their house; the opposite mortgage loan only appear because upon a borrower’s dying or once they move out.

Reverse mortgage loans help senior residents pay money for expenses like medical, renovations or issues. The equity could be paid-in one lump sum, or consumers may choose for monthly obligations.
